초록
In this paper, we propose the application of an optical property-enhancement film that complements the angular dependence and total reflection of top-emitting organic light-emitting diodes (TEOLEDs). The optical property-enhancement film is composed of a porous pyramid arrangement applied on a thin-film encapsulation layer of TEOLEDs and is applied to distribute the transmitted light evenly. The results confirm that the change in the electroluminescence spectrum for each angle was effectively reduced because the TEOLEDs demonstrated uniform light distribution. In addition, reducing the total internal reflection in the film structure made it possible to improve the external quantum efficiency by approximately 35% and current efficiency by 38%.
